I was inspired to share this idea from the other going to K thread. My son starts in September and I will do this same thing that I did when my dd started.
Get a copy of "The night before kindergarten" to read together. (do this even if you dont want to make this card!)
Copy the poem and custom edit to suit you.
Get an adorable picture of your child. I went to walmart and had one taken of her holding books with a school bus in the background. Cute! (3ish years ago.)
Create fold over cards. (buy blank ones that fit into your printer)
On the front I wrote:
Introducing: The Graduating Class of 2017 (or whatever, I cant recall, and dont want to do the math again right now!
)
Inside was the Night before kindergarten poem that I custom edited, and the picture of my then almost 5 yo dd announcing that she started K. The neighbors, family and friends all LOVED IT! (I was inspired as my older son was graduation high school the next year!)
I cant recall the exact poem, but it was sort of leaning to the way of "Mommy is tender right now". It was sweet. If anyone is really interested, I have it somewhere and can find it.
